Colored pencils are excellent for detailing the hair and beard textures, as well as shading the robe and cape. Fine-tip markers or gel pens can add crisp outlines and metallic accents to the buckle.
Start by coloring the large areas like the cape and robe using light, even strokes. Use a simple, consistent color for the hair and beard, staying within the lines. Choose 3-4 complementary colors for the main attire. Don't worry about perfect blending; focus on filling spaces neatly.
Create texture in the beard and hair using directional strokes and subtle shading to imply depth. Experiment with blending multiple shades on the cape and robe to achieve realistic fabric folds and movement. Use highlights and shadows on the belt buckle to give it a metallic sheen.
